Output 122666ba7d1c32443d292c2e12af8fcaca984aed439d1d3e6e71baf63ad8ee16:0

value
426557436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e883238389b632591f8ff1fd059b00c947da6d OP_EQUAL
address
34h25vASnrdEGnKi7gm1xuu5NVCfsH7c3i
transaction
122666ba7d1c32443d292c2e12af8fcaca984aed439d1d3e6e71baf63ad8ee16
spent
true